How to care for your down jacket?

Down jackets are popular every winter season. They’re soft, elastic and warm, they also ensure optimal body temperature. Valuable down features waterproof and windproof properties, it’s lighter than feathers and provides higher level of comfort. If you own jackets filled with goose down read below and find out how to take care of them. Wash, dry and store the clothes in a proper way and use them for a longer period of time.

down jacket washing

Before washing clothes, read the instructions given on the label. It is usually placed on the inside part of the jacket or attached to the product.If you want to keep your down jacket in a good form for at least a few seasons, treat it carefully. Before washing, make sure that all pockets are empty and zips are fastened. Remove belts, linings and all possible accessories. Choose hand washing cycle or a cycle for delicate fabrics available in your washing machine. Maximum water temperature: 40°C, always use proper detergents, avoid using fabric softeners and rinse the clothes carefully (even 2 or 3 times), you can spin it slowly.

drying down jackets

Down jackets can be dried in electric driers, maximum temperature: 40°C. If you decide to dry your clothes in a traditional way, always avoid placing wet jackets on a warm radiator or in the Sun. Dry them in a horizontal position and make sure that the down is evenly distributed. Fluff the jacket a few times.

If you are afraid of washing your favourite jacket on your own, you can always use the services of professional dry cleaner’s.

the storage of down jackets


The maintenance of down clothing is not only about proper drying and washing. After winter season hang your jacket on a coat hanger in a big cotton dust cover or keep it loosely folded in a big carton. Don’t press it with heavy objects and store it in a dry place.
